    Crystal L.

    Dumpling King is probably only place in Brevard county to get soup dumplings, so I was def excited to try it. The steamed soup dumplings have soup in it, to avoid burning yourself- place it on a Chinese soup spoon and carefully pierce it with your chopsticks before biting into it as the hot steam of the soup escapes. The crab pork steamed dumplings had the sweetness of the seafood, and tasted very freshly made. Note that the skins are on thicker side than I am accustomed to, but my hubby preferred it that way so they don't leak when you pick it up w chopsticks. Make sure to dip it in the vinegar sauce, which is already on the table. We also tried the braised pork belly over rice dish, it was good and had umami and savory flavors with notes of five spice, star anise... The side dish (curry beef noodles soup) was ok, not much going on other than noodles in curry soup... could have added some scallion or cilantro to garnish. Would def come back when I'm craving soup dumplings again as this hit the spot and don't have to trek to Orlando. Final NOTE, as someone who is Chinese American, THIS IS NOT DIMSUM! Another reviewer (perhaps on google) incorrectly stated they serve Dimsum here. No, dimsum is from Hong Kong, which quintessentially would serve tea and ladies push carts with steamed dumplings like Har gow, Siu mai, cherng fun, lotus sticky rice, etc. **Soup dumplings are Shanghainese**, and the rest of this restaurant's menu seems to be more from Northern China, where they prefer things heavier, pan fried or spicier (the menu says they use hot Mala sauce in their dips), which you would never find at dimsum. Just want to clear it up any confusion.
